Frequently Asked Questions

How many units are in this program?
There are 48 units in this program.

How many units do I take each semester?
Full-time students take six units every nine weeks. However, many candidates are working adults and do not take classes full time. Academic advising is highly recommended to determine the course load required.

How long is a semester?
A semester is nine weeks, including final exams. Most classes are offered in accelerated nine-week terms.

How many hours does each class session require?
Classes meet for approximately 4 hours and 15 minutes, once a week.

How many evenings per week do I attend classes?
Most students attend classes one evening per week.

How many students will there be in my classes?
APU is noted for its small classes with personalized attention. Most courses do not exceed 15-20 students.

Does APU require theses, dissertations, or capstone projects?
This program culminates in a comprehensive exam only.

What is the description of the average student in this program?
The program consists of approximately 60 percent women and 40 percent men with a racial representation including Caucasian, Hispanic, African American, and Asian Americans.

Are scholarships available?
While APU does not offer scholarships to graduate students, several types of financial aid are available. The sources include federal loans, state grants, and fellowships. Please contact the Office of Graduate Student Financial Services for more information (626) 815-4570.

How soon can I finish this program?
This program could be completed in a year. Depending upon the desired course load, working individuals usually finish this program in 18-24 months.

What is the cost per unit?
Most graduate programs average about $495 per unit for the 2007-08 academic year. This varies depending upon the program, and other fees may also apply. The current information may be obtained in the Graduate Catalog under the Student Financial Services section.
